Filters
14-18 Automatic Rd, Brampton, ON L6S 5N5 Get directions
Vinyl Windows, Side Entrance, Store Fronts, Porch Enclosures, Enlarge Windows, Commercial Windows, Storm Doors, Curtain Wall System
A small player in a thriving industry Customer Choice Windows and Doors Inc. has been serving its community since 1987. Two years ago January 2007 after many years of extensive re... more... See more text
<< Rate these results
Redo search from here
Esri, TomTom, Garmin, FAO, NOAA, USGS, © OpenStreetMap
Go to Merchant Page
Get Directions
Back to Top
Close menu